Buyer's Guide

What to Look for in a Floor Scrubber

Motor Power & RPM Rating

For carpet cleaning, aim for 1500-2000 RPM to lift dirt without damaging fibers. Lower RPM units lack agitation power; higher RPM may fray delicate carpets. Commercial machines like the VEVOR deliver 1900 RPM for professional results.

Cord Length & Mobility

A 40+ foot cord eliminates outlet hunting in large rooms. Wheeled designs reduce fatigue during extended use. Manual brushes work for small areas but require physical effort.

Brush & Pad Versatility

Stiff bristles penetrate deep pile; softer pads maintain low-pile carpet. Machines with multiple attachments (like VEVOR's six-piece set) handle diverse cleaning scenarios without extra purchases.

Weight & Maneuverability

Commercial units weigh 30-40 pounds for stability but need wheels for transport. Portable models under 20 pounds suit multi-level homes. Manual brushes weigh under 2 pounds but demand elbow grease.

Surface Compatibility

Verify carpet-specific design—hard-floor-only machines like the Hoover FloorMate lack appropriate brushes and may void warranties. Multi-surface units offer better value for mixed flooring.

Commercial vs Residential Grade

Commercial machines withstand daily use with metal components and longer warranties. Residential units prioritize light weight and storage. Match the build quality to your cleaning frequency.

Frequently Asked Questions

Cleaning — FAQ

Can floor scrubbers actually clean carpet effectively?
Yes, when equipped with carpet-specific brushes or pads. Orbital and rotary machines agitate fibers to lift embedded dirt that vacuums miss. Avoid hard-floor-only units like the Hoover FloorMate for carpet tasks.
What's the difference between a floor scrubber and carpet extractor?
Scrubbers agitate and lift soil; extractors spray water and vacuum it out. Scrubbers work for maintenance cleaning, while extractors handle deep restoration jobs requiring water extraction.
What RPM is best for carpet cleaning?
1500-2000 RPM provides optimal soil removal without fiber damage. The VEVOR's 1900 RPM hits the sweet spot. Below 1000 RPM lacks power; above 2000 RPM risks carpet fraying.
Should I choose a commercial or residential floor scrubber?
Commercial units (like VEVOR and HHQ) withstand daily use and offer better long-term value for large homes or businesses. Residential models suit occasional cleaning in small spaces.
Are corded floor scrubbers better than cordless for carpet?
Corded models deliver consistent power for extended jobs—critical for carpet cleaning. The VEVOR's 43-foot cord covers most rooms. Cordless units lose suction as batteries drain.
How do I maintain my floor scrubber for carpet use?
Clean brushes after each use to prevent fiber buildup. Check for carpet strands wrapped around the drive shaft weekly. Store with cords wrapped loosely to prevent internal wire breakage.
